The process itself must be approached with utmost care and sensitivity. Before even considering a paintbrush, thorough preparation is crucial. This includes:
Choosing the right paint: Only use paints specifically designed for pets, ensuring they are non-toxic, water-based, and easily washable. Research brands thoroughly and check reviews to avoid any potential allergic reactions.
Desensitization and positive reinforcement: Introduce your dog to the paints gradually. Let them sniff and explore the brushes before applying anything to their fur. Use positive reinforcement techniques, like treats and praise, to create a positive association with the process.
Short and sweet sessions: Never force your dog to participate. Keep the sessions short and sweet, allowing for breaks if they show signs of discomfort or stress. Observe their body language closely; a yawning dog or one that's trying to move away needs a break.
Professional guidance (optional): Consider consulting with a professional pet groomer or animal behaviorist, especially if you're working with a sensitive or anxious dog. They can provide invaluable advice and guidance on ensuring a positive and stress-free experience.
Safety first: Always supervise your dog closely during the painting process, ensuring they don't lick the paint or ingest it. Have plenty of clean water available.
